[EVE-NG] Hướng dẫn import cisco IOL vào EVE server

Để có thể sử dụng hệ điều hành IOL của cisco nhằm giả lập Router và Switch, trước hết chúng ta cần phải có file IOL mong muốn trên máy tính thật của mình. Tiếp theo là sao chép vào thư mục thích hợp trên EVE server. Đường dẫn đến thư mục này trên EVE server là :

/opt/unetlab/addons/iol/bin/

(Ở đây mà đã xây dựng và chuẩn bị sẵn EVE server trên Windows, các bạn có thể tham khảo tài liệu  thêm về cách build một EVE-NG server)

Để copy file IOL từ máy thật lên EVE server ảo, một chương trình thông dụng thường được dùng là WinSCP.
  • WinSCP là một chương trình mã nguồn mở chạy trên Windows. Có thể download tại đây: 
https://winscp.net/eng/download.php
  • Link tải về file IOL kèm theo key
https://drive.google.com/drive/u/1/folders/0B48bfm_V0Vz2NlJJSUh4ZFZJZ1E

A. Sao chép file IOL vào thư mục trên EVE server


Sau khi tải WinSCP về máy ta cài đặt như các phần mềm thông thường. Ta bắt đầu thao tác mở WinSCP lên, của sổ login hiện ra, nhập đỉa chỉ ip của EVE server, username, password và những thông số yêu cầu để truy cập SSH tới EVE server. 


Sau khi nhập xong nhấn "Login" để đăng nhập 

Sau khi hoàn thành đăng nhập, giao diện hai cửa sổ của chương trình sẽ hiện ra: một bên là cây thư mục của máy thật và một bên là cây thư mục của EVE server 



Chú ý: Trong giao diện này ta phải chỉnh đường dẫn thư mục của 2 cửa sổ đến các thư mục cần thiết : cửa số bên trái  trỏ đến thư mục chứa file IOL và cửa sổ bên phải trỏ đến thư mục /opt/unetlab/addons/iol/bin/ trên EVE server để chép các file IOL vào.

Nhấn chuột phải vào từng file và chọn Upload. Quá trình upload diến ra như sau: 



Sau khi quá trình chép file thành công, trên EVE server ta kiểm tra đã có những file cần thiết trong thư mục hay chưa



Đến đây ta đã hoàn tất quá trình sao chép file IOL vào thư mục thích hợp trên EVE server

Chú ý:
           
L3-ADVENTERPRISEK9-M-15.2-M5.3.bin     là bản IOL đùng để giả lập Router 
L3-ADVENTERPRISEK9-M-15.4-2T.bin 
L2-ADVENTERPRISEK9-M-15.2-20150703.bin    là bản IOL đùng để giả lập Switch L2 
L2-ADVENTERPRISEK9-M-15.2-IRON-20151103.bin     là bản IOL đùng để giả lập Switch L3

B. Tiến hành active cho license


IOL là các file hệ điều hành về nguyên tắc chỉ được lưu hành nội bộ trong đội ngũ của Cisco , để sử dụng chúng, người dùng cần phải có file license được cấp bởi Cisco. Trong bước này, chúng ta sẽ cùng thực hiện các thao tác để crack các file IOL có được bằng cách chạy một chương trình keygen tạo ra file license cho các file IOL này. 

----> Trong file download IOL ở trên mình đã chuẩn bì đầy đủ các file cần thiết để crack.

Trên EVE server ta thực hiện di chuyển đến thư mục chứa các file đã sao chép và xem tất cả những thư mục đó

root@eve-ng:~# cd /opt/unetlab/addons/iol/bin/
root@eve-ng:/opt/unetlab/addons/iol/bin# ls








Tiến hành chạy file keygen bằng python

root@eve-ng:/opt/unetlab/addons/iol/bin# python CiscoIOUKeygen.py












Thực hiện cấp quyền để các file IOL được quyền truy nhập và chạy


root@eve-ng:~# /opt/unetlab/wrappers/unl_wrapper -a fixpermissions

Kiểm tra license

root@eve-ng:~# cat /opt/unetlab/addons/iol/bin/iourc










Đăng nhập vào Lab EVE và kiểm tra kết quả







Chúng ta đã hoàn tất toàn bộ quá trình cài đặt EVE để sử dụng IOL giả lập router và switch Cisco.

Chúc các bạn thành công!




Nhận xét

  1. Bài viết rất hay và đầy đủ, tôi đã làm theo hướng dẫn và thành công. Cảm ơn bạn

    Trả lờiXóa
  2. Anh có thể cấp lại file down IOL được không ạ

    Trả lờiXóa

Đăng nhận xét

Bài đăng phổ biến từ blog này

[EVE-NG] Hướng dẫn kết nối thiết bị ảo với Internet thông qua cổng vật lý máy thât.

[LAB] Hướng dẫn cấu hình NAT overload qua mô hình lab trên EVE-NG